How they compare
Senegal currently reports 3.66 million against 3.63 million in Paraguay, a difference of 31,420.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Paraguay ahead.
Paraguay ranks 61st and Senegal ranks 59th of 121 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Paraguay averaged higher in 2 and Senegal in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Paraguay | Senegal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 457,226 | 465,042 | 7,816 | Senegal |
| 1970s | 647,429 | 763,952 | 116,523 | Senegal |
| 1980s | 910,062 | 1.15 million | 235,397 | Senegal |
| 1990s | 1.34 million | 1.59 million | 248,146 | Senegal |
| 2000s | 2.10 million | 2.11 million | 11,055 | Senegal |
| 2010s | 2.93 million | 2.73 million | 202,250 | Paraguay |
| 2020s | 3.48 million | 3.39 million | 94,145 | Paraguay |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Population in urban agglomerations of more than one million is the country's population living in metropolitan areas that in 2018 had a population of more than one million people.
